What Key Features Should You Look for in a Hair Dryer for Short Hair?

To choose the best hair dryer for short hair, consider features that enhance styling and minimize damage. Look for effective heat and airspeed controls, lightweight design, and compact size.

  5. Ion Technology:
    Ion technology releases negatively charged ions, which can help combat frizz and static. This technology is beneficial for short hair, as it often requires a polished finish. A study by the Journal of Cosmetic Science found that ion dryers lead to smoother results compared to traditional models (Taylor et al., 2019).

  6. Diffuser Attachment:
    A diffuser is useful for creating volume and texture in short hair. It spreads out the airflow, preventing excessive heat on specific areas. This accessory is ideal for users with wavy or naturally textured short hairstyles.

  7. Quick Drying Time:
    Quick drying time is a sought-after feature for short hair, allowing for efficient styling. Advanced motor technology and optimized airflow contribute to this feature, making it easier to achieve desired looks quickly, especially for busy individuals.

  8. Quiet Operation:
    Quiet operation can enhance the user experience, making drying less disruptive. Some brands focus on developing quieter motors without sacrificing power, which can be particularly beneficial in shared living spaces.

  9. Cool Shot Button:
    The cool shot button helps set hairstyles in place by using cool air. This feature is essential for creating lasting styles, as it closes the hair cuticle after drying. Users report that a cool shot function helps reduce frizz and improves overall hair texture.

  10. Warranty and Customer Support:
    A solid warranty and efficient customer support demonstrate product reliability. Users appreciate knowing they have recourse in case of defects or issues. Many consumers suggest choosing brands with comprehensive coverage to ensure long-term satisfaction and support.

How Can You Maintain a Hair Dryer for Optimal Performance when Styling Short Hair?

To maintain a hair dryer for optimal performance when styling short hair, ensure regular cleaning, proper storage, and mindful usage.

Regular cleaning: Dust and lint can accumulate in the hair dryer, obstructing airflow and affecting performance. Clean the air inlet regularly. Use a soft brush or a cloth to remove debris. It is advisable to perform this cleaning every few weeks, especially if you use the dryer frequently.

Proper storage: Store the hair dryer in a cool, dry place. Avoid wrapping the cord tightly around the dryer, as this can damage the cord over time. Instead, loosely store the cord to maintain its integrity. Ensure that the dryer is unplugged to prevent any electrical hazards when storing.

Mindful usage: Avoid using high heat settings on short hair, as this can lead to heat damage. Use the medium or cool setting, which is gentler on hair and helps to maintain moisture. Hold the hair dryer at least six inches away from your hair to prevent overheating. Additionally, use a heat protectant spray on your hair before styling to further mitigate heat damage.

Check for wear: Inspect the cord and plug for any signs of wear or damage. If you notice fraying or any issues, replace the dryer immediately to ensure safety. Regular checks can prevent potential electrical hazards.

By following these practices, you can help ensure that your hair dryer remains effective and prolong its lifespan while styling short hair.
